Overview
- Fabrizio Romano reports “big movements” in the last 48 hours and says Jackson is definitely set to leave very soon, with a decision expected shortly.
- Bayern Munich and Newcastle United have contacted Chelsea again in recent days to ask about the Senegal forward.
- Aston Villa are pushing for Jackson, with Unai Emery keen on a reunion from their time together at Villarreal and talks reported over the deal structure.
- Maresca confirmed Jackson is available but will not be in the West Ham matchday squad as the club evaluates solutions.
- Summer arrivals Joao Pedro and Liam Delap have pushed Jackson down the pecking order, accelerating Chelsea’s willingness to let him go.
